NY: Sterling Publishing Company. Very Good in Very Good dust jacket. 2006. First Edition; First Printing. Hardcover. 1402740859 . xix, 299pp. Signed by the author on the title page. Endpaper map, black and white frontispiece illustration, foreword, black and white photos and illustrations, appendices, notes, bibliography, index, and picture credits. Resolute is the epic story of the frenzied search for this Holy Grail of trade routes, the disappearance of Franklin and his hundred and 128 men, and the longest, largest and in the end, the most controversial search and rescue mission ever organized. ; 8vo 8" - 9" tall .
